About my journey
A hybrid career spanning across academia, consultancy, and evidence-based practice.
-
Building upon a former senior managerial HR role and several positions in consultancy, I’ve successfully led initiatives in workplace mental wellbeing, leadership development, organisational change management, and delivered executive coaching’s across Australia and Europe.
-
Since 2018, am running my own coaching and consulting business as I know how important it is to translate research into practice – this is almost 10 years ago and still counting! I delivered tailored workshops focussing on stress management, work design, and leadership development across a broad range of industry sectors.
My freelance activities also included assessment services for mid senior and senior positions (up to c-level). I also started to deliver coaching sessions with an evidence-based focus and completed a coaching education certified by the International Society for Coaching Psychology (ISCP).
-
My academic journey reaches back more than 15 years exploring the dynamics of work design, occupational resilience, and workplace mental health. I’ve contributed to and worked in international projects and published my work in top-tier journals.
I also still work in a Senior Lecturer role and collaborate with different universities, industry partners, and policymakers to translate research into impactful practice.
